Description
This free app with no Ads has been specifically designed for Volt/Ampera vehicle owners and displays hidden information not brought up to the car dashboard.Before downloading this App, please understand that additional hardware is required. A Bluetooth OBD2 adapter is required(ELM327) and should be plugged into the OBD2 socket of the car on the driver side.
Presented in an easy to read layout, your device will show you:
- Instant power drawn from the the main traction battery
- indication showing when the friction brakes are applied
- Graph of instant power of each of the electric motors
- Clear bar chart showing temperature of battery, transmission, AC/DC converter and gas engine coolant
- Energy utilization breakdown for main traction, HVAC, Battery heater and other components
- Daily statistics as energy usage, electric and gas miles
- Actual and raw state of charge of the battery
- Min, max and average cell voltage
- And a lot more data from selectable sensors
Both metric and Imperial units are supported
